Once in Chartres, the main event is, of course, the Cathedral Notre-Dame de Chartres. Recognized globally for its stunning Gothic architecture, the cathedral features an incredible 4,000 sculptures adorning its facades, each telling biblical stories or commemorating saints and kings. You’ll have the chance to get up close and examine these intricate carvings, which often reveal artisan details not visible on casual visits.
The cathedral’s stained-glass windows are rightly famed, with 176 of them depicting biblical scenes and stories in vivid color. These windows aren’t just beautiful—they’re also educational, illustrating stories that have captivated viewers for centuries. Many reviews highlight how guides like Lilith or Corrine add layers of context, explaining the symbolism and history behind each window.
Another highlight is the labyrinth at the heart of the nave—a 42-foot maze that has intrigued visitors for generations. Your guide will share its myth and meaning, giving you a richer appreciation of its role in medieval spiritual practice. Descending into the 11th-century crypt offers a glimpse into early Christian architecture, with frescoes, chapels, and jamb statues adding to the cathedral’s layered history.
